Dripping Dishwashing machine


This is probably the most day-to-day dish washer problem, as well as the good news is that it is very easy to identify. Leakages occur as a result of several reasons, and also the leakages can make a mess of your kitchen area. Common root causes of dishwashing machine leaks include;
  • Inappropriate pipe connection: If the pipes at the rear of your equipment are not firmly fixed or if they are worn, it can cause leakages.

  • Improper dish piling: Constantly ensure that you do not overstack the tray which you set up the dishes correctly

  • Way too much cleaning agent: Putting sufficient cleaning agent might also trigger a leakage. Guarantee that you place simply sufficient for your recipes and also not a lot more.

  • Corrosion: It might additionally be a result of some corrosion or deterioration of your machine. In this situation, it is better to replace the dishwashing machine.

  • Door Seals: Examine if the door seals are still intact as well as firmly fastened. If the seals are not ready, maybe a substantial cause of leaks.

  • Bad-Smelling Dishwasher


    This is an additional typical dishwasher trouble, as well as it is mostly brought on by food debris or oil sticking around in the machine. In this instance, seek these particles, take them out and do the meals without any dishes inside the device. Clean the filter thoroughly. That will assist do away with the negative scent. Make sure that you get rid of every food bit from your recipes before transferring it to the maker in the future.

    Inability to Drain


    Sometimes you may see a large amount of water left in your bathtub after a clean. That is possibly a drain trouble. You can either check the drainpipe tube for damages or clogs. When in doubt, get in touch with an expert to have it checked and also fixed.

    Does not clean properly


    If your recipes and cutleries come out of the dishwasher and also still look unclean or unclean, your spray arms might be a trouble. In many cases, the spray arms can obtain blocked, and it will certainly require a fast clean or a replacement to function effectively once again.

    Dishwasher Won’t Drain? 8 Steps to Fix It


    Run the Disposal


    A full garbage disposal or an air gap in a connecting hose can prevent water from properly draining out of the dishwasher. Simply running the disposal for about 30 seconds may fix the issue.


    Check for Blockages


    Check the bottom of the dishwasher to make sure that an item or pieces of food haven't fallen from the rack to block the water flow.


    Load the Dishwasher Correctly


    Make sure you’re loading the dishwasher correctly. Read the manufacturers’ instructions or owner’s manual for tips and directions on how to load dishes for best results.


    Clean or Change the Filter


    You may have a clogged dishwasher filter that’s preventing water from draining. Many homeowners don’t realize that dishwasher filters need to be cleaned regularly. Check your owner’s manual to see where the filter is located on your dishwasher, and for instructions on how and when to clean it. For many dishwashers, the filter can be found on the inside bottom of the appliance.


    Inspect the Drain Hose


    Check the drain hose connecting to the sink and garbage disposal. Straighten any kinks that you may see, which could be causing the problem. Blow through the hose or poke a wire hanger through to check for clogs. Make sure the hose seal is tight, too.


    Try Vinegar and Baking Soda


    Mix together about one cup each of baking soda and vinegar and pour the mixture into the standing water at the bottom of the dishwasher. Leave for about 20 minutes. If the water is draining or starting to drain at that time, rinse with hot water and then run the dishwasher’s rinse cycle. That may be enough to help loosen any clogs or debris that are preventing the dishwasher from draining properly.


    Listen to Your Machine While It's Running


    Listen to your dishwasher while it’s running a cycle. If it doesn’t make the usual operating sounds, particularly if it’s making a humming or clicking noise, the drain pump and motor may need replacing. If this occurs, it may be time to call a professional for help.
